We are looking for an experienced qualified Accountant and a Chartered Tax Advisor (CTA) to provide specialist tax advice and support to our client’s multinational clients, ensuring compliance with UK tax laws while offering strategic tax planning. This role involves working with individuals, businesses, and corporate clients.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Tax Compliance: Preparing and reviewing tax returns (corporation tax, VAT, income tax, capital gains tax, inheritance tax).
  • Tax Planning & Advisory: Providing proactive tax planning strategies to optimize tax efficiency.
  • Legislation & Compliance: Ensuring clients comply with UK tax laws and regulations.
  • Client Liaison: Advising individuals, SMEs, and large corporations on tax matters.
  • HMRC Correspondence: Handling HMRC queries, investigations, and negotiations.
  • International Tax: Advising on cross-border tax issues (if applicable).
  • Business Development: Identifying new tax planning opportunities for clients.
  • Audit & Risk Management: Reviewing tax structures for compliance and efficiency.
  • Review & management: Working closely with colleagues in reviewing and finalising accounts and tax returns.

Essential Skills & Qualifications:

  • Qualifications: CTA qualification (Chartered Tax Adviser), possibly ACCA, ACA, or ATT.
  • Experience: Typically, 5 -7 + years in tax advisory and accounting firms.
  • Technical Knowledge: In-depth understanding of UK tax laws, regulations, and HMRC guidelines.
  • Analytical Skills: Ability to interpret complex tax legislation and apply it to client situations.
  • Communication: Spanish and Italian Language would be beneficial, written and verbal skills to explain tax concepts to clients.
  • Attention to Detail: Accuracy in tax calculations and compliance reviews.
  • Software Proficiency: Experience with tax software (e.g., Quickbook, Xero, Sage & TaxCalc).
